Separation and Purification of Total Flavonoids From Toona sinensis Leaves by Macroporous Resins

ZHANG Jing-fang and WANG Dong-mei*   

  1. (College of Forest, Northwest A &F University,Yangling,Shaanxi 712100,China)
  • Received:2007-06-25 Revised:2007-09-12 Online:2007-12-25 Published:2007-12-25

Abstract: In order to establish the technology for separating and purifying total flavonoids from Toona sinensis leaves with macroporous resin, 6 types of macroporous resins were selected to be investigated. The results showed that LSA-10 was the best for separating and purifying total flavonoids in the following conditions: the loaded concentration of total flavones 0.653 mg/mL, pH4.0-5.5, the flow rate 240 mL/h; amount of saturated adsorption for total flavones 440-480mL; 400 mL 50% ethanol as appropriate the eluting reagent, eluting rate 80 mL /h. The purity of total flavonoids purified by LSA-10 was 75.2% when purified four times under the optimal conditions.

Key words: Toona sinensis, Leaf, Total flavonoid, Macroporous resin, Separation, Purification
